Q: Is 6,475,926 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 6,475,926 is a composite number.

Why is 6,475,926 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 6,475,926 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 23 46 69 138 167 281 334 501 562 843 1,002 1,686 3,841 6,463 7,682 11,523 12,926 19,389 23,046 38,778 46,927 93,854 140,781 281,562 1,079,321 2,158,642 3,237,963 and 6,475,926, with no remainder.

Since 6,475,926 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,475,926, it is a composite number.
